Surge Analysis using BOSfluids Training Course

This training course is the starting point to improving your effectiveness in solving transient flow and pressure surge (water hammer) problems. During this 2-day training course, Surge Analysis using BOSfluids, you will learn how to solve surge/water hammer problems and other transient flow issues such as relief valves or tube rupture. The course will be formed of a series of seminars and varied case examples based on the consulting experience of DRG. In doing the examples participants will make use of the software BOSfluids. BOSfluids has been specially developed by DRG to assess the transient flow behavior of liquid and gas carrying piping systems. During these example exercises participants will learn how to use BOSfluids effectively. No prior experience in BOSfluids is required. The training course will be given by an experienced trainer from DRG, who is not only regularly involved in surge studies during his daily work, but is also actively working with the software development team to improve BOSfluids further.

Course details

Intended for:

  • Those involved with and dealing with surge and transient flow problems in piping systems
  • Users of BOSfluids
  • Learning more about the capabilities BOSfluids

Prerequisites:

Basic knowledge of flow analysis is not required but beneficial.

Topics

  • Water hammer/surge fundamentals
  • BOSfluids fundamentals
  • Modelling pumps
  • Ways of categorizing flow
  • Modeling and analysis of various upset conditions
  • Tube rupture
  • Blow down scenarios
  • Modelling of surge tanks and vacuum breakers
  • Determination of unbalanced loads

Highlights

  • Important points to consider in conducting a surge analysis.
  • Explanation of all of the features of BOSfluids.
  • Numerous examples to gain proficiency in using BOSfluids.
  • Theoretical background to fluid transients in piping systems.
